A real-time dashboard is a powerful tool that displays up-to-date information from your business operations as it happens. In Microsoft Fabric, real-time dashboards allow organizations to monitor key metrics, track performance, and make instant, data-driven decisions by connecting to live data sources across OneLake, lakehouses, and other integrated workloads.
What is a Real-Time Dashboard
A real-time dashboard continuously updates metrics and visualizations to reflect the latest data. Unlike static reports, these dashboards provide instant insights, allowing teams to react immediately to changes in operations, sales, or customer behavior.

Key Features of Real-Time Dashboards in Microsoft Fabric
- Live Data Connections: Pull data directly from OneLake, lakehouses, streaming sources, or external APIs.
- Automatic Refresh: Visualizations update automatically without manual intervention.
- Interactive Visuals: Use charts, KPIs, maps, and tables that respond to filters and slicers in real time.
- Alerts and Notifications: Set thresholds to trigger alerts when metrics exceed or fall below targets.
- Integration with AI: Combine dashboards with predictive analytics or anomaly detection models for actionable insights.
Steps to Build a Real-Time Dashboard
Step 1: Identify Key Metrics
- Determine which KPIs and data points need real-time monitoring.
- Examples: sales orders, website traffic, production output, or inventory levels.
Step 2: Connect Data Sources
- Use Power BI connectors or Microsoft Fabric integrations to pull live data from:
- OneLake or lakehouse tables
- Streaming sources such as IoT devices
- External APIs or databases
Step 3: Transform and Prepare Data
- Use Dataflows Gen2 or pipelines to clean, merge, and structure incoming data.
- Ensure that metrics are calculated correctly for live updates.
Step 4: Build Visualizations
- Create KPIs, cards, line charts, and tables that reflect real-time data.
- Add filters and slicers for interactive analysis.
Step 5: Configure Automatic Refresh
- Enable live or near real-time data refreshes.
- Set update frequency based on business needs.
Step 6: Set Alerts and Notifications
- Configure thresholds and triggers for important metrics.
- Receive notifications via email or integrated systems when anomalies occur.
Step 7: Share and Collaborate
- Publish the dashboard to Power BI Service for team access.
- Apply Row-Level Security (RLS) to restrict sensitive data.
- Embed dashboards in applications or internal portals for wider visibility.
